Continuing work on the Defiler. Added a bit more detail to the claws and added a daemonic face to the Defiler gun. Also added a flamer to the left arm.

Found out that Guitar string makes excellent twisted wires...

I finished painting that Chick from Hell who's been hanging around the painting desk for last several months. Taking the opportunity, I also made a very specific mixture of inks and paints (trace amount of Black Ink, about 10 times that of Red Ink, some Blood Red and a lot of Scab Red, all watered down heavily), which I used to apply a wash/glaze to the previous CfH models. They look 10x better, as the wash has deepened the red substantially. Now the tint is more like spilled blood - which is that much better for Dark Eldar.
I also used the very same mix to add blood splatters on their weapons. Yow! They sure look mean now...
